Dear aspirant

First of all individual subject marks is not checked in any competitive exams as well as neet also,so you don't need to worry about your English marks. As you have scored 42 marks which you passed that subject successfully.

For NEET eligibility criteria only aggregate marks are needed.

The class 12 percentage required for NEET 2022 exam is separate for each category and can be listed as under. NEET eligibility marks in class 12 to be considered are aggregate marks only for PCB subjects

  • UR - 50%,

  • OBC/SC/ST - 40%,

  • PWD - 45%

As you have got 62.33 ( 59+75+53 = 187×100/300) aggregate marks in your PCB subject, which is above NEET UG eligibility criteria and you fulfill that.

Hello Aspirant,

As you’re studying Bsc biotechnology, I would like to suggest you to do diploma courses in few of the subjects, as it will help you with practical knowledge and will be beneficial for your future job aspects.

1. Diploma in Nutrition

- You can work as a dietician in both public and private hospitals (subject to pass in RD exam). Alternately, you can work in private practise by starting your own clinic or by forming a partnership with doctors, diabetologists, endocrinologists, gynaecologists, paediatricians, dentists, etc. Additionally, you can work as a taste specialist or quality assessor in the food and chocolate industries.

2. Diploma in DMLT

- You can begin working in the laboratory. High income and good self-employment prospects are available. In state government hospitals and laboratories, there are openings for laboratory staff. The PSC Test is used for selection. In the private sector, there are more job prospects. BSc plus DMLT will get you extra money.
